Output 15259f057a43495381e561dda1fba6650a36c5e19e8e7d51bb354af8c387717c:1

value
522
script pubkey
OP_0 OP_PUSHBYTES_20 76f78ec296676fdcf8e16151f84f1b28019c425d
address
bc1qwmmcas5kvahae78pv9glsncm9qqecsjauzm9j2
transaction
15259f057a43495381e561dda1fba6650a36c5e19e8e7d51bb354af8c387717c
confirmations
170359
spent
true